The cost of damaged siding replacement in Dallas, TX can vary significantly based on a variety of factors. Whether you're dealing with minor repairs or a complete siding overhaul, understanding the elements that influence pricing can help you budget more eff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Siding: Different materials like vinyl, wood, or fiber cement have varying costs.
- Extent of Damage: Minor repairs are less costly than extensive damage requiring full replacement.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Dallas can affect the overall cost of the project.
- Removal of Old Siding: Costs can increase if old siding needs to be removed and disposed of.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Customizations: Any custom work or special features will increase the price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Dallas, TX) |
---|---|
Minor Siding Repairs | $300 - $700 |
Full Vinyl Siding Replacement | $6,000 - $13,000 |
Full Wood Siding Replacement | $7,000 - $15,000 |
Full Fiber Cement Siding Replacement | $8,000 - $17,000 |
Removal and Disposal of Old Siding |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$200 - $500 |
